Summary : Benedictine nunnery founded 1125-35 dissolved 1525. Small scale excavations in 1964 revealed the foundations of the chancel to the East of the modern church. The North wall of the chancel, dated to the 13th century, is aligned with the North wall of the present modern church, the North wall of which is also 13th century, and of 3 arcades. A stone coffin was also found. |
